Latest Patents

Ryu's latest patent focuses on the "Intermediates for optically active piperidine derivatives and preparation methods thereof." This preparation method allows for the industrial production of large quantities of highly pure optically active tert-butyl 3-methyl-4-oxopiperidine-1-carboxylate. The approach utilizes commercially available reagents and solvents, enabling high yields of this essential compound. By introducing novel intermediates, Ryu's method stands out as a significant advancement in the production of optically active compounds.
